India’s surfing circuit will witness a significant moment this week as the seventh edition of the ‘Indian Open of Surfing 2026’ begins at Blue Bay Tannirbhavi Eco Beach in Mangalore from May 29 to 31.
The championship arrives at a crucial time as surfing prepares for its debut at the Aichi-Nagoya Asian Games later this year.
More than 80 surfers from Karnataka, Kerala, Tamil Nadu, Telangana, Andhra Pradesh, and Goa will compete across Men’s Open, Women’s Open, Under-18 Boys, Under-18 Girls, Under-14 Boys, and Under-14 Girls categories.
Organisers expect fierce competition as limited national team positions remain available for the Asian Games squad.
The event, organised by Mantra Surf Club and Surfing Swami Foundation under the Surfing Federation of India, has steadily evolved into a major national sporting fixture.
The Karnataka government has supported the competition for seven consecutive years.
Surfers including Ramesh Budihal, Shivaraj Babu, Kishore Kumar, and Srikanth D will headline the men’s division.
Budihal previously created history after becoming the first Indian to reach the Open Men’s final at the Asian Surfing Championships in Mahabalipuram, where he secured a bronze medal.
The women’s field will feature leading surfers Kamali P and Sugar Shanti Banarse, both recognised for consistent performances nationally and internationally.
The championship also serves as the second stop in the National Championship Series following the Little Andaman Pro 2026.
Officials believe the event will further strengthen Mangalore and Dakshina Kannada’s reputation as emerging hubs for surfing and coastal sports tourism in India.
